It's a Numbers Game
Roulette is a game of pure chance, but its outcomes are governed by the laws of probability. The key element is the "house edge," which is the casino's built-in advantage. Understanding the math behind the wheel can't change the odds, but it can help you make more informed decisions and appreciate the game on a deeper level.

Keeping it Fun and Safe
Gambling should always be a form of entertainment, not a way to make money. It's essential to stay in control and know when to stop. Responsible gambling means treating it as a recreational activity with a budget. Losing control can lead to harmful consequences.

Beyond the Spinning Reels
Slot machines are the most prevalent attraction in any casino, casino - pop over to this site - both online and offline. Their ease of play is a major draw, but there's complex technology working behind the scenes. Every modern slot machine uses a Random Number Generator (RNG) to guarantee that every spin's outcome is completely random and independent of previous spins.
